# Approvals: Cold Storage Archival

Archiving a cold storage bucket in the Frostbin tier requires two approvals: one from the owning team and one from data governance. Before approving, confirm the bucket has had no reads for 180 days and that legal hold flags are clear. Archived buckets are immutable for seven years. Final archival authority for this process rests with the person named below.

account owner for bawip-tahag: Raleth Quenok

**Action item (Thornkey outage, week 12):** Bloom filter in front of the Thornkey KV store was sized for last year's keyspace; false-positive rate hit 14%, causing read amplification and the Tuesday latency spike. Owner: storage team. Resize filter to current cardinality plus 40% headroom, add an FPR alert at 3%, and automate quarterly re-sizing. Target: end of sprint. Sizing math and rollout plan are on the internal page below.

wiki page, kagep-bajog: https://sentry.braskdata.internal/issue

## Runbook: Sheetgate CSV Import Wizard Release

Support team: after each Sheetgate release, confirm the import wizard accepts the sample files in the regression folder and that delimiter detection still handles semicolons. If customers report rejected uploads, check the signature status first, since unsigned builds silently disable imports. Every hotfix build must be verified using the signing key below.

rollout seal: bky4_x7Gc

## Changelog — 2.8.1 Key Rotation

Rotated the deploy key for the Ferngate serverless fleet after the quarterly audit. Note: handlers will cold-start on first invoke post-rotation since warm pools were flushed; expect elevated latency for roughly ten minutes. No config changes needed on your side beyond updating the verifier. Old key is revoked as of this release. The replacement key is provided below.

deploy key for kajof-fajop: bky6_gDHw9Q